Dr. Amol Chintaman Badgujar is an Associate Professor in the School of Technology Management and Engineering at SVKM NMIMS Global University, Dhule. With over a decade of expertise in academia and research, his work focuses on Materials Engineering, Thin Film Photovoltaics and Advanced Manufacturing. Dr. Badgujar earned his Ph.D. in Metallurgical Engineering and Materials Science from the Indian Institute of Technology Bombay. His research contributions span the development of CIGS thin-film solar cells, transparent conductive electrodes, nanomaterials and laser-based materials processing. His research work has been published in reputed international journals, including ACS Omega, Solar Energy, ACS Applied Energy Materials, and Journal of Alloys and Compounds. Dr. Badgujar has also presented his research at several national and international conferences in India and abroad. Apart from research, Dr. Badgujar is actively involved in teaching undergraduate and postgraduate courses in Materials Science, Additive Manufacturing and Manufacturing Processes. He is recognized as a Ph.D. Supervisor and has contributed to curriculum development under NEP guidelines, institutional academic audits, NBA activities and AICTE initiatives, such as Technical Translations in Regional Languages. His current areas of interest include Thin Film Photovoltaics, Additive Manufacturing, Machine Learning applications in engineering, and advanced materials processing. He is also a reviewer for several international journals and a life member of professional bodies, including the Indian Laser Association, Solar Energy Society of India and ISTE.
